The width of the Lamando is 1826mm. Below is a detailed introduction to the Lamando: 1. The Lamando is a high-performance compact coupe under the Volkswagen brand, with dimensions of 4610mm in length, 1826mm in width, 1425mm in height, and a wheelbase of 2656mm. 2. Exterior: As a compact wide-body coupe, the Lamando is positioned between the Passat and the Lavida. It targets the high-end sporty compact car market, ensuring daily driving comfort while living up to its sporty reputation. The Lamando follows Volkswagen's family-style front grille in its exterior design, with a wide and low front end that highlights its sporty characteristics. 3. Interior and Space: The interior features a minimalist design style with meticulous material selection and craftsmanship, embodying German engineering. The three-spoke multifunction steering wheel sets a new benchmark for Volkswagen's design style, with more powerful multifunction control buttons and a straight-edged bottom contour that reflects a racing-inspired design. The instrument cluster with a barrel-style design remains a favorite among young drivers, featuring white numerals on a black background with red needles for clear visibility.

I've been paying close attention to the dimensions of the Lamando, and its width is approximately 1826 mm, equivalent to 1.826 meters, which has a significant impact on daily driving. The width of the car body directly affects interior space and handling. In the compact sedan segment, the Lamando's dimensions are considered moderate, offering ample legroom and headroom in both the front and rear seats without feeling cramped. Having driven it a few times, I found this width provides good maneuverability when turning in urban areas, though extra caution is needed when parking in tight spots, as modern city parking spaces are often compactly designed. Combined with its well-balanced length and height, the fuel consumption remains reasonable at around 6-7L/100km, thanks to efficient aerodynamics. The width also contributes to safety—a wider body enhances high-speed stability and reduces the risk of rollovers, especially during rainy conditions. If you're considering buying one, it's advisable to measure your garage door width beforehand to avoid any inconvenience later.

How Long is the Door Lock Warranty for Geely Binyue?

Geely Binyue's door lock warranty lasts for 4 years. The vehicle warranty for Geely Binyue is 4 years or 100,000 kilometers. Additionally, Geely Motors has introduced an unprecedented engine warranty policy of "300,000 kilometers or 8 years," which not only alleviates consumer concerns with sincerity but also demonstrates full confidence in the Binyue model. Conditions for vehicle warranty: Vehicle warranties come with many conditions. The warranty period represents the maximum duration, and different components may have varying warranty periods. Consumers should particularly pay attention to the warranty duration and conditions for consumable parts. Many manufacturers specify in the owner's manual that consumable and wear-and-tear parts are not covered under warranty unless they are due to quality issues. Differences in vehicle warranty periods: Generally, the warranty periods for the engine and transmission are the same as the overall vehicle warranty. However, consumable parts such as batteries, air filters, cabin air filters, and timing belts have much shorter warranty periods. Furthermore, the Maintenance Manual typically states that wear-and-tear parts like wiper blades, brake pads, clutch plates, tires, headlights, and glass are not covered under warranty.

What brand is the automatic transmission of the Lavida?

The automatic transmission of the Volkswagen Lavida is divided into two types: the Lavida 1.6 automatic model uses the Aisin 6-speed automatic manual transmission, while the 1.4T model uses the DSG dual-clutch transmission. The functions of the transmission are: Changing the transmission ratio to expand the range of torque and speed changes of the driving wheels; enabling the car to reverse while the engine's rotation direction remains unchanged. The transmission, also known as the gearbox, is a mechanism used to change the speed and torque from the engine, and it can fix or change the transmission ratio between the output shaft and the input shaft in steps. Classification of transmissions: Stepped transmissions use gear drives and have several fixed transmission ratios; continuously variable transmissions can continuously obtain any transmission ratio within the range; integrated transmissions refer to hydraulic mechanical transmissions composed of a torque converter and a stepped gear transmission.

Can the BMW X6 use 92 octane gasoline?

BMW X6 cannot use 92 octane gasoline. The manufacturer requires 95 octane or higher. Recommended fuel: Under normal circumstances, it is not recommended to switch to gasoline with an octane rating lower than the standard specified in the vehicle manual. Using lower-octane gasoline may cause premature combustion, leading to engine knocking. Additionally, incomplete combustion can increase carbon deposits, resulting in clogged conduits and nozzles, as well as fuel supply interruptions and vehicle stalling. Difference between 92 and 95: The difference between 92 octane and 95 octane gasoline is not about quality but the content of added isooctane, which affects the gasoline's anti-knock properties. 95 octane gasoline has a higher isooctane content, making it slightly more expensive and providing better anti-knock performance. Different anti-knock properties are suitable for engines with different compression ratios. High-compression engines require 95 octane gasoline, while low-compression engines can use 92 octane gasoline.

What is the real fuel consumption of the Haval Big Dog 2.0?

The combined fuel consumption of the Haval Big Dog 2.0T is 7.2-8L/100km. Currently, there are three models of the Haval Big Dog 2.0T on sale. The combined fuel consumption of the two-wheel-drive Zhonghua Liequan version is 7.2L/100km. The four-wheel-drive Xiaotianquan version and the four-wheel-drive Zhonghua Tianyuanquan version have a combined fuel consumption of 8L/100km. The above figures are NEDC combined fuel consumption, which are the comprehensive fuel consumption data measured under the NEDC test procedure. The real fuel consumption is higher than this value, ranging from 9.7-10.7L/100km. The fuel consumption of a car is directly related to five major factors: driving habits, the car itself, road conditions, natural wind, and environmental temperature. Specific factors that can increase fuel consumption are as follows: Driving habits: Aggressive driving, such as sudden acceleration, frequent overtaking, and not easing off the throttle before encountering a red light, will increase fuel consumption. The car itself: Cars with larger displacements generally consume more fuel than those with smaller displacements because larger displacements usually mean higher power, requiring more gasoline to burn and perform work. Heavier cars also consume more fuel because greater weight requires more driving torque. Road conditions: Driving on dirt roads, muddy roads, soft surfaces, or mountainous roads increases resistance and fuel consumption. Natural wind: Driving against the wind or on windy days increases car resistance and fuel consumption. Low environmental temperatures: When the engine block temperature is low during cold starts, the injected gasoline is less likely to atomize, requiring more gasoline to be injected for combustion, thus increasing fuel consumption. Additionally, in low temperatures, the engine computer controls the car to use higher RPMs to warm up, which also increases fuel consumption.
